
The average NVIDIA UX Researcher in Seattle earns an estimated $136,535 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$108,128 with a $28,407 bonus. NVIDIA's UX Researcher compensation is $40,138 more than the US average for a UX Researcher. UX Researcher salaries at NVIDIA in Seattle can range from $66,300 - $198,000.

In Seattle, UX Researchers earn $8,215 more than UI/UX Designers, and $17,499 less than Senior UI/UX Designers.
In Seattle, The Design Department averages $4,195 more than the Sales Department, and $8,138 less than the IT Department
The average female UX Researcher at companies similar size to NVIDIA reported making $110,058, while the average male U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$116,203.
The average Asian or Pacific Islander UX Researcher at companies similar size to NVIDIA reported making $109,961, while the average African American/Black U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$87,812.
The majority of UX Researchers at NVIDIA believe they're compensated fairly. 43% of UX Researchers at NVIDIA say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(85%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at NVIDIA
